Key Insights
The South African facility management (FM) market, valued at approximately ZAR 75 billion in 2025, is experiencing robust growth, projected to expand at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 4.62% from 2025 to 2033. This growth is driven by several factors. The increasing adoption of outsourced FM services across various sectors, particularly commercial and industrial, reflects a shift towards efficiency and cost optimization. Furthermore, a burgeoning construction industry and expanding urban centers contribute to heightened demand for comprehensive FM solutions. The rise of smart building technologies, including IoT-enabled systems for energy management and building automation, is another key driver. Growing awareness of sustainability and corporate social responsibility is also influencing FM practices, leading to increased demand for green building certifications and sustainable FM services. Finally, the South African government’s investment in infrastructure development further fuels the market's expansion.
Despite these positive drivers, the South African FM market faces certain challenges. Economic volatility and fluctuating exchange rates pose risks to investment and market stability. Skills shortages, particularly in specialized areas like sustainability management and technology integration, represent another constraint. Furthermore, competition amongst numerous FM providers necessitates ongoing innovation and differentiation to maintain market share. However, the long-term outlook remains positive, with continued growth expected across all segments: in-house vs. outsourced FM, hard vs. soft FM services, and across various end-user sectors, including commercial, institutional, public/infrastructure, and industrial. The market’s segmentation offers significant opportunities for specialized FM providers to target specific needs and niches.

Key Markets & Segments Leading South African Facility Management Market
The South African facility management market is segmented by type (in-house vs. outsourced), offering type (Hard FM vs. Soft FM), and end-user (commercial, institutional, public/infrastructure, industrial, others). The outsourced facility management segment is experiencing faster growth, driven by the increasing need for specialized expertise and cost optimization. Hard FM currently holds the largest market share, while soft FM is witnessing significant growth fueled by rising focus on employee well-being and workplace experience.
- Dominant Segment: Outsourced Facility Management is the fastest-growing segment.
- Drivers by Segment:
- Outsourced FM: Cost optimization, access to specialized expertise, scalability.
- Hard FM: Infrastructure development, growing industrial sector.
- Soft FM: Focus on employee well-being, improved workplace experience.
- Commercial: Growth in office spaces and commercial real estate.
- Institutional: Increasing demand for specialized services in education and healthcare.
- Public/Infrastructure: Government initiatives for infrastructure development.
The commercial sector currently dominates the end-user segment, driven by the expansion of office spaces and commercial real estate. However, the public/infrastructure sector is poised for significant growth due to governmental investment in infrastructure projects.

8. Can you provide examples of recent developments in the market?
March 2023 - Red Rocket, a South African independent power producer, has placed a 373MW wind turbine contract with the Danish wind turbine manufacturer Vestas. The business will deliver 64 of its V150-4.5MW wind turbines, 12 of its V163-4.5MW turbines, and five of its V162-6.2MW Enventus turbines. The Brandvalley, Rietkloof, and Wolf wind parks, located in South Africa's Western and Eastern Capes, will host the installation of the turbines.
